    I think 10.1 just put the playlists in the Music folder, not in any subfolder, but with 10.2 they are in a folder called Playlists. I might be remembering wrong though. Playlists have the filename extension ".m3u".

    I have a phantom Playlist. It shows in the Music app as "Unknown". the songs shown in it reveal it to be an old Christmas Playlist that I had. The songs in the Playlist are not found, and I am unable to delete this playlist. I searched the Flash and SD memory for all m3u files, and there does not seem to be one that I can see that is associated with that entry. I even removed all Playlists from the device (NO m3u's), and this "Unknown" still shows. When I choose Delete, and Confirm, nothing happens. If I open it, select Edit, and try to give it a name, I get "Error saving Playlist". If I try to remove, add, or alter the songs within it, I get the same error as soon as I try to save the changes. Hate seeing it, but can't get rid of it. :-(
